You will be surprised to know that some people believe that New York is the capital of the U.S, as it's the largest and probably the best known city in the country. Well, it really WAS the first capital of the United States once the Constitution was ratified. The creation of a capital district located on the country's East Coast began in 1790. Since 1800, Washington, D.C., formally the District of Columbia is the capital of the United States.


Note from history: The U.S. Constitution provided for a federal district under the exclusive jurisdiction of the Congress, that's why the District is not a part of any U.S. state.
